The Eminent Advisory Committee on Thursday, January 30, 2020, met with IPAC and the Electoral Commission (EC) over a decision to compile a new voters register.
The meeting was also attended by some representatives of civil society organizations, former Independent presidential candidates and many others
The National Democratic Congress (NDC) after the meeting has raised some issues including the fact that the Commission's proposed date of completing the new voters' register was not satisfactory.
The Member of Parliament for the Adentan Constituency, Yaw Buabeng Asamoah reacting to this said the meeting has rather exposed the biggest opposition party in the country.
